Quote:
2) I do use versamail (although I have not set it up a schedule for it to automatically download), and I also use Toccer (a free IM provider), but I have noticed that I miss calls at times (routed directly to voicemail)--and I have noticed that when this happens the two little green arrows are also usually lit, indicating that I am downloading information (although I have noticed) this also at times when I am logged off of IM. Ive tried the various things that I've found elsewhere on the site for people who seemed to have similar issues, but hasn't worked for me thus far. Anyother suggestions or input?
On a CDMA carrier like Sprint, you will always miss calls when using data. There's no real workaround except to use data less...

Quote:
3) lastly, is there a way to disable the touchpad when you are on a call? I can always use the navigational keys to end a call, etc., and i'd rather do that then continue to hold the handset super far from my face so that I dont accidentally end the call (which REALY sucks when you've already been on hold for 5 minutes....trust me).
Open your Prefs app. It's under Keyguard.
